So, 'Amaanaaiy' from 1998 is a deep dive into domestic life, exploring how one unexpected visit can ripple through a seemingly perfect family. Zahid and Shafeeqa are enjoying a seemingly ideal marriage, complete with two daughters who bring warmth to their lives. But then Bakurube shows up, and everything shifts. The film captures a blend of emotional depth and family drama; it’s a slow burn that lets you really feel the characters’ struggles. The performances are solid, with a subtlety that's refreshing. You can almost feel the weight of Zahid's revelations. There’s something raw and honest about the way it tackles themes of family, trust, and the shocking truths lurking beneath the surface. It’s not flashy, but it definitely lingers with you.
